When’s the Best Time to Go?
Pomarangai enjoys a temperate climate, making it a great destination year-round. Summer (December-February) offers warm weather perfect for swimming and hiking, while autumn (March-May) and spring (September-November) provide pleasant temperatures for exploring. Winter (June-August) can be chilly, but it offers a different kind of beauty, with stunning winter landscapes.
